Make AI agents that never see your data
Astra is a cutting-edge SaaS tool designed for developers and data privacy professionals who need to build AI agents without exposing sensitive information. Its core innovation lies in tokenizing protected health information (PHI), payment card information (PCI), and personally identifiable information (PII) before data reaches the AI model. This approach ensures that raw sensitive data remains unseen by the AI, significantly reducing privacy risks while maintaining the model’s ability to reason and act on the data at execution time. Astra’s simplicity—just two lines of code—makes it accessible for integration into any AI agent framework, making it ideal for teams prioritizing security and compliance without sacrificing efficiency or functionality. Its unique approach to data anonymization enables organizations to deploy AI solutions confidently where data sensitivity is paramount, such as in healthcare, finance, and legal sectors.

The AI assistant that already knows your work
Littlebird is an AI-powered virtual assistant designed to seamlessly integrate with your workflow by understanding the context of your work. Unlike traditional assistants, Littlebird builds a private memory of your projects, meetings, and priorities by observing your screen activity and transcribing conversations. It connects the dots across various apps and conversations, providing highly relevant answers and suggestions grounded in your actual work environment. Its ability to operate without requiring integrations makes it particularly user-friendly and easy to set up, appealing to professionals who want a smarter, more intuitive assistant that adapts to their needs. Whether you're managing projects, preparing drafts, or seeking quick insights, Littlebird aims to streamline your productivity with personalized support based on your unique work habits.
